The Efficiency of Ultrasonic Quilting

Ultrasonic quilting integrates sound wave technology to bond fabric layers, offering a cleaner and faster alternative to traditional sewing techniques. As an industry expert, Sarah Thompson, a renowned textile engineer, emphasizes, "Ultrasonic quilting not only reduces production time but also minimizes material waste, making it an eco-friendly option." This technology allows home textile businesses to produce more with less, aligning with sustainable practices.
